This week, Tokyo Academics Lead Admissions Consultant Jennifer Liepin shares invaluable insights on college preparation for high school juniors. As students approach this critical juncture in their academic journey, Jennifer breaks down the essential action items that can make a significant difference in their college admissions process. From strategic academic planning to extracurricular optimization, she offers expert guidance on how juniors can position themselves for success in the upcoming admissions cycle. Whether you're a student, parent, or educator, this episode provides a practical roadmap for navigating the pivotal months ahead of senior year applications.
